Jodi Taylor is an English author of fantasy-style historical fiction, [1] historical romance [2] and romance [3] [4] novels.
Jodi Taylor was born in Bristol. [5] With her then-husband, Taylor moved to Yorkshire. [6] She worked for North Yorkshire County Council for almost 20 years, [6] in positions including library facilities manager. [7]
Taylor's first book, Just One Damned Thing After Another, was self-published on two download websites. [3] That manuscript was subsequently purchased by Accent Press, [6] which published all her subsequent works, up to December 2018. Headline Publishing Group became responsible for publishing her works as of January 2019.
As of 2024, Jodi Taylor lives in Gloucestershire. [8]
Just One Damned Thing After Another appeared on the USA Today Best-Selling Books list on 21 January 2016 at #74. [9] It earned a starred review from Publishers Weekly, which called it "a carnival ride" in a "world ... depicted in lush detail". [10] The review in Library Journal lauded the book's "appealing cast of characters", with "plenty of humor, lots of action, and even a touch of romance". [11]
The first fan convention, Jodiworld, [12] was held in Coventry, UK, in June 2023. Taylor and her literary agent (and former publisher), Hazel Cushion, were in attendance, with Jasper Fforde as an additional Guest of Honour.
Taylor's flagship series follows the staff of St Mary's Institute of Historical Research, especially historian Dr Madeleine "Max" Maxwell, as they time-travel to "investigate major historical events in contemporary time". [13]
